Home Work 2

Pedal and push rod.. The pedal is the piece of tubing on the left side,
Ball bearings, bicycle parts etc

And on the Pug.. It's a bit to far from the foot rest but I can't
move it any more forward due to the kick start, and I can't drop the launch lever pedal lower
for the same reason.. It's a pretty tight spot with a lot of stuff going on..

Over all it seem to work as intended, just need to do some minor tweaks to the push rod..

Inga kommentarer:

Skicka en kommentar